PROBLEM TO BE SOLVED: To provide a disk memory device and an eccentricity learning processing reexecuting method capable of successfully loading a head on a disk by calculating learned values even if of the disk changes in disk environments make discrepancies between learned initial eccentricity measured in advance and currently learned values. SOLUTION: This is an eccentricity learning processing reexecuting method for a disk memory which positions the head by using servo data. It periodically monitors a converging state of the learned values in a learning processing step which moves the head to a predetermined position on the disk to compute coefficients to determine the feed forward controlled amount for eliminating positional errors due to disk revolutions. When the learned values do not converge within a predetermined period, it judges whether the difference between the samples indicates a monotonous decrease or not, and switches the reexecuting method according to the result of the judgement.
